Economics

Department of Economics

B.A.(Ⅰ)
Paper Titles Programme Outcome Programme Specific Outcome/Course Outcome
1.Micro Economics
2.Macro Economics
The course in Economics is three year undergraduate programme, which has been designed for the students to get equipped with the finer and broader details of economic world. The student is educated in the economic concepts in such a manner that he/she get equipped with various fields of economics and enhance their job opportunities. The paper in Micro Economics will improve the understanding of the students related to fundamentals of Microeconomics. The student is expected to understand the supply and demand concept with the forces that determine equilibrium in market economy. They will be able to solve basic microeconomic problems. In Macro economics students will get an overview of the theories of Macroeconomics. They will get acquainted to interrelationship between various variables of Macroeconomics.
